3.0

I enjoyed this series for the most part, but was mainly reading for the nostalgia from when i was younger. Some things definitely didn’t sit right with me at the same time though. I really didn’t like that Luke admitted to liking Annabeth at the end, even though when he met her she was 6 or 7 and he was around 14. That part made me uncomfortable. The plot was interesting, and I’ll always love greek mythology retellings, but parts of this book definitely could have been better written.
